Dr. Baffour Awuah; New Director General of the Ghana Health Service

Nana Addo Dankwah Akuffo Addo has appointed Dr. Baffour Awuah of the Komfo Anokye Teaching Hospital as the new Director General of the Ghana Health Service.

He replaces Dr. Nsiah Asare who according to report has been reassigned to take a role as the President’s Health advisor.

Dr. Awuah, a graduate of the Kwame Nkrumah University of Science and Technology (KNUST) School of Business, is a Consultant Radiation Oncologist who has been working at the KATH since June 2010.

Confirmed by a letter dated on November 5, 2019 signed by the Secretary to the President, Nana Bediatuo Asante which detailed that, “the President of the Republic has appointed you to act as Director General of the Ghana Health Service (the ‘Service’), pending receipt of the constitutionally required advice of the governing board of the Service, given in consultation with the Public Services Commission.

‘I take this opportunity to congratulate you formally on your appointment, within 14 days of receipt of this letter’

‘Please accept the President best wishes’
